Migos feature on new Justin Bieber single "Looking For You"

Justin Bieber has shared a new single “Looking For You,” and it features hefty contribution from Atlanta hip-hop trio Migos.
The song is composed of your standard club-dance pop fare, with the Biebs headed to the club in search of a lady-friend, receiving ample hyped-up hoots and hollers from Migos all the way. The collaboration works surprisingly well, with Migos’ to-the-point, double-timed rhymes and background hype highlighting Bieber’s more laid-back vocal lines throughout the track.
